Amkor Technology Market Risk Analysis

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Amkor Technology's investment risk. Standard deviation is the most common way to measure market volatility of stocks, such as Amkor Technology, and traders can use it to determine the average amount a Amkor Technology's price has deviated from the expected return over a period of time. It is calculated by determining the expected price for the established period and then subtracting this figure from each price point. The differences are then squared, summed, and averaged to produce the variance.

Amkor Technology, Inc. provides outsourced semiconductor packaging and test services in the United States and internationally. Amkor Technology, Inc. was founded in 1968 and is headquartered in Tempe, Arizona. AMKOR TECHN operates under Semiconductors classification in Germany and is traded on Frankfurt Stock Exchange. It employs 30850 people.
